Athlete Development Pathways and Recruitment Trends

The pathways to professional sports have become increasingly complex and competitive. Gone are the days when talent alone guaranteed success; today, athletes require a combination of skill, physical conditioning, mental fortitude, and strategic guidance. Recruitment processes have correspondingly evolved, incorporating advanced scouting methods, data analytics, and a greater emphasis on academic performance and character assessment. The role of youth sports programs, high school athletics, and collegiate sports in shaping future professionals is paramount. Successful athletes often benefit from early exposure to quality coaching, competitive environments, and opportunities to showcase their abilities. The scouting networks employed by professional teams now extend their reach to identify potential talent at younger ages, leading to earlier commitments and increased pressure on young athletes.

The Impact of Social Media on Recruitment

Social media has fundamentally altered the landscape of athlete recruitment. Platforms like Twitter, Instagram, and TikTok provide athletes with a direct channel to showcase their skills, build their personal brand, and connect with recruiters. Highlight reels, game footage, and personal stories shared online can significantly influence a recruiter’s decision-making process. However, social media also presents potential pitfalls, as athletes’ online behavior is subject to scrutiny and can impact their reputation. Recruiters often assess an athlete’s social media presence to gauge their character, maturity, and professionalism.

Financial Aspects of Athlete Recruitment and Development

The financial implications of athlete recruitment and development are substantial. Investing in youth sports programs, coaching staff, training facilities, and scouting networks requires significant financial resources. The potential return on investment, however, can be considerable, particularly for professional teams and leagues. Athletes who reach the highest levels of competition command lucrative salaries, endorsement deals, and sponsorship opportunities. The rise of name, image, and likeness (NIL) deals in collegiate sports has further complicated the financial landscape, allowing student-athletes to profit from their personal brand while in school. This introduces new challenges and opportunities for both athletes and institutions.

Understanding NIL Deals and Their Impact on Collegiate Athletics

Name, Image, and Likeness (NIL) deals represent a paradigm shift in collegiate athletics, permitting student-athletes to monetize their personal brand through endorsements, appearances, and social media promotions. This has created a complex regulatory environment, with varying state laws and evolving NCAA guidelines. The potential for significant financial gains has attracted athletes to certain schools and influenced recruitment decisions. It has also raised concerns about competitive balance and the potential for exploitation. Clear guidelines and oversight are essential to ensure that NIL deals are fair, transparent, and do not compromise the academic integrity of higher education.

Emerging Technologies in Sports Analytics and Performance Enhancement

Technological advancements are revolutionizing sports analytics and performance enhancement. Wearable sensors, GPS tracking devices, and video analysis tools provide coaches and trainers with unprecedented insights into athletes’ physical condition, movement patterns, and performance metrics. This data-driven approach allows for personalized training programs, injury prevention strategies, and optimized game strategies. The adoption of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) is further accelerating these trends, enabling predictive analytics, automated performance assessments, and real-time feedback for athletes. The ability to quantify performance and identify areas for improvement is transforming the way athletes train and compete.
